Created in 1990, Cartoon Forum is a unique event focusing on pitching sessions of pre-selected TV projects, where animation producers can find cross-border partners and speed up financial arrangements. It allows co-productions to be finalised, pre-buys agreed, negotiation of distribution agreements, options discussed on every type of right, and licensing of secondary rights.

Since 2019, CARTOON has been fostering connections between publishing and animation professionals from the early stages of projects, creating business opportunities and encouraging expansion across both sectors. So this year Cartoon Forum welcomes the Bologna Children’s Book Fair (BCBF), world’s leading children’s publishing event with over 1,500 exhibitors from about 100 countries, to the event.
This new partnership with the Bologna Children’s Book Fair, through its TV/Film Rights Centre designed to support networking between producers and publishers, symbolises a powerful synergy between screen and page.
